As of January 30, a new temporary homeless shelter will be open in Regina. The Government of Saskatchewan, the City of Regina, Regina Treaty/Status Indian Services (RT/SIS), and The Nest Health Centre are collaborating on the initiative after the RT/SIS received $400,000 in operational funding from the provincial government. Regina’s City Council approved its first 2-year budget on December 16 and it wasn’t approved without controversy. One of the main arguments during the budget was on the homelessness motion which had a plan to eradicate homelessness in the city within two years.
